Oklahoma’s 24–13 win over Michigan wasn’t just a Saturday night statement—it was the beginning of something bigger. In this episode, we break down how transfer quarterback John Mateer is redefining OU’s identity with poise, toughness, and leadership that feels tailor-made for the SEC. From his efficient execution under pressure to the game-sealing drive in the fourth quarter, Mateer is proving to be the difference-maker Sooner Nation has been waiting for. But the story doesn’t end on the field. With more than 70 recruits in Norman for the game, the Sooners turned a prime-time showdown into a recruiting showcase. Within days, OU landed four-star wide receiver Demare Dezeurn, and momentum is already building toward commitments from elite targets like quarterback Peyton Houston and cornerback Mikhail McCreary. In Trust iHeartPodcasts and Bloomberg A hundred and fifty years ago, the Osage Nation bought a stretch of prairie the size of Delaware, in what's now Oklahoma. The Osage owned the land and everything beneath it. Today, much of present-day Osage County has left Osage hands. In some cases, appropriation was swift and brutal: Dozens of Osages were murdered for their share of lucrative mineral rights to this oil-rich land, a period often referred to as the Reign of Terror.
